I just got the codes for a new key from Hyundai...it
unlocks driver door only? This isn't right by any
means. My lost key(singular here))) unlocked all
doors AND turned my ignition. What gives

2 Answers

44,815

idk- go back and ask the dealer- it is always a mistake to have only one key for your car- but you get it-

13,095

Sounds like it was not cut properly. Does it work the same on both sides of the key, or didn't you try flipping it? It could be cute a bit too deep or not quite deep enough.
